1. The Kuwait E-Commerce Boom in 2026: KWD Purchasing Power & KNET Hegemony
Kuwait possesses one of the most affluent, digitally active retail consumer bases on earth. Powered by the Kuwaiti Dinar (KWD)—consistently the world's highest-valued currency unit—and near-universal 5G connectivity across the country, online transactions have become the default method of purchasing fashion, luxury perfumes, cosmetics, electronics, and lifestyle goods.
However, the Kuwaiti e-commerce landscape functions unlike any Western or Asian market:
KNET is Absolute King: Over 85% of domestic transactions in Kuwait are paid using the national KNET (Kuwait Network Electronic Transfer) debit network. Consumers do not use traditional revolving credit cards for everyday local shopping; they pay directly from their checking accounts via KNET.
Biometric 1-Tap Apple Pay: Kuwait has achieved over 90% iPhone market penetration in premium retail segments. Shoppers expect instant Face ID checkout without filling out tedious multi-step billing forms.
Zero-Friction 1-Page Expectation: Kuwaiti shoppers abandon carts at alarming rates (exceeding 75%) when an e-commerce website forces multi-page reloads, sluggish redirects to third-party bank portals, or awkward currency conversions.
To capture and convert Kuwait's high-spending shoppers, a retail platform cannot merely be translated; it must be architecturally engineered around KNET, MyFatoorah, Tap Payments, and local Kuwait delivery expectations.

Why Shopify Penalizes Kuwaiti Businesses
Shopify's business model relies heavily on its proprietary payment processing service, Shopify Payments. In countries where Shopify Payments is active (such as the United States or the UK), merchants pay 0% extra platform transaction fees.
However, Shopify Payments does NOT exist in Kuwait.
Because Shopify Payments is unavailable in the country, every single Kuwaiti retailer is forced to connect a local third-party payment gateway—such as MyFatoorah, Tap Payments, or a direct bank gateway from NBK or Boubyan.
When you do this, Shopify extracts an additional 0.5% to 2.0% platform transaction penalty fee on every single sale your business makes.

8. Governorate & City Commerce Breakdown: Kuwait City, Hawally, Salmiya, Farwaniya, Ahmadi & Jahra
To achieve dominant search rankings, your store architecture must cater to the distinct commercial hubs across Kuwait's six governorates:
1. Kuwait City (Capital Governorate / العاصمة)
The financial and governmental epicenter (Sharq, Mirqab, Qibla). High concentration of corporate professionals buying luxury goods, formal wear, and premium electronics with expectation for express same-day office delivery.
Kuwait's premier lifestyle and retail district. Home to Marina Mall, Salem Al-Mubarak shopping street, and prominent fashion boutiques. High demand for beauty, cosmetics, and trendy apparel with active mobile checkout.
3. Farwaniya & The Avenues (Farwaniya Governorate / الفروانية)
Kuwait's highest population density and home to The Avenues—the largest mall in Kuwait. Massive volume of omnichannel retail requiring seamless synchronization between physical showroom inventory and online storefronts.
4. Al Ahmadi & Al Kout (Al Ahmadi Governorate / الأحمدي والفحيحيل)
Kuwait's southern commercial powerhouse, centered around Fahaheel, Al Kout Mall, and residential growth in Sabah Al Ahmad Sea City. Fast-growing demand for home goods, lifestyle brands, and automotive accessories.
5. Al Jahra & Mubarak Al-Kabeer (الجهراء ومبارك الكبير)
Rapidly expanding retail markets characterized by large family shopping baskets, strong preference for KNET and Tabby/Tamara split payments, and doorstep courier delivery.
